Tenaris brings Pennsylvania plants back online

Tenaris plans to beef up its US operations by restarting two key mills in Pennsylvania and getting its employee headcount up to 1,000, Kallanish learns from a 15 April statement.  Tenaris plans to reopen its Koppel melt shop in June, following a $15 million revamp operation, and it will reopen its Ambridge seamless mill in late summer “...following a period of temporary suspension due to the depressed market conditions.” The statement was release…
